Oct. 3rd, 2007 03:04 pmSo, apparently if the project you pick doesn't get completely funded, the money gets returned in the form of credits. This makes me sad for those poor AP kids in Texas who didn't even get the $60 they'd raised so far. I want to write the teacher or something and say post it again!
